Preheat oven to 250 degrees.
In a bowl combine the lime zest, olive oil, bread crumbs, parsley, mustard seeds, lime juice, Dijon mustard, and sugar substitute. Place the salmon fillets in baking dish, skinned-sides down and sprinkle with pepper. Place some of the lime coating on each fillet.
Bake the salmon for 25 to 30 minutes until done. Serve hot or at room temperature.
This recipe yields 4 servings.
Exchanges Per Serving: 4 Lean Protein, 1 Fat.
Nutrition Facts: 282 calories (54% calories from fat), 29 g protein, 17 g total fat (2.4 g saturated fat), 3 g carbohydrates, 1 g dietary fiber, 78 mg cholesterol, 109 mg sodium.
